| /* | 
 |  *  entry.S -- non-mmu 68000 interrupt and exception entry points | 
 |  * | 
 |  *  Copyright (C) 1991, 1992  Linus Torvalds | 
 |  * | 
 |  * This file is subject to the terms and conditions of the GNU General Public | 
 |  * License.  See the file README.legal in the main directory of this archive | 
 |  * for more details.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Linux/m68k support by Hamish Macdonald | 
 |  */ | 
 |  | 
 | #include <linux/linkage.h> | 
 | #include <asm/thread_info.h> | 
 | #include <asm/unistd.h> | 
 | #include <asm/errno.h> | 
 | #include <asm/setup.h> | 
 | #include <asm/segment.h> | 
 | #include <asm/traps.h> | 
 | #include <asm/asm-offsets.h> | 
 | #include <asm/entry.h> | 
 |  | 
 | .text | 
 |  | 
 | .globl system_call | 
 | .globl resume | 
 | .globl ret_from_exception | 
 | .globl ret_from_signal | 
 | .globl sys_call_table | 
 | .globl bad_interrupt | 
 | .globl inthandler1 | 
 | .globl inthandler2 | 
 | .globl inthandler3 | 
 | .globl inthandler4 | 
 | .globl inthandler5 | 
 | .globl inthandler6 | 
 | .globl inthandler7 | 
 |  | 
 | badsys: | 
 | 	movel	#-ENOSYS,%sp@(PT_OFF_D0) | 
 | 	jra	ret_from_exception | 
 |  | 
 | do_trace: | 
 | 	movel	#-ENOSYS,%sp@(PT_OFF_D0) /* needed for strace*/ | 
 | 	subql	#4,%sp | 
 | 	SAVE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	jbsr	syscall_trace_enter | 
 | 	RESTORE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	addql	#4,%sp | 
 | 	movel	%sp@(PT_OFF_ORIG_D0),%d1 | 
 | 	movel	#-ENOSYS,%d0 | 
 | 	cmpl	#NR_syscalls,%d1 | 
 | 	jcc	1f | 
 | 	lsl	#2,%d1 | 
 | 	lea	sys_call_table, %a0 | 
 | 	jbsr	%a0@(%d1) | 
 |  | 
 | 1:	movel	%d0,%sp@(PT_OFF_D0)	/* save the return value */ | 
 | 	subql	#4,%sp			/* dummy return address */ | 
 | 	SAVE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	jbsr	syscall_trace_leave | 
 |  | 
 | ret_from_signal: | 
 | 	RESTORE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	addql	#4,%sp | 
 | 	jra	ret_from_exception | 
 |  | 
 | ENTRY(system_call) | 
 | 	SAVE_ALL_SYS | 
 |  | 
 | 	/* save top of frame*/ | 
 | 	pea	%sp@ | 
 | 	jbsr	set_esp0 | 
 | 	addql	#4,%sp | 
 |  | 
 | 	movel	%sp@(PT_OFF_ORIG_D0),%d0 | 
 |  | 
 | 	movel	%sp,%d1			/* get thread_info pointer */ | 
 | 	andl	#-THREAD_SIZE,%d1 | 
 | 	movel	%d1,%a2 | 
 | 	btst	#(TIF_SYSCALL_TRACE%8),%a2@(TINFO_FLAGS+(31-TIF_SYSCALL_TRACE)/8) | 
 | 	jne	do_trace | 
 | 	cmpl	#NR_syscalls,%d0 | 
 | 	jcc	badsys | 
 | 	lsl	#2,%d0 | 
 | 	lea	sys_call_table,%a0 | 
 | 	movel	%a0@(%d0), %a0 | 
 | 	jbsr	%a0@ | 
 | 	movel	%d0,%sp@(PT_OFF_D0)	/* save the return value*/ | 
 |  | 
 | ret_from_exception: | 
 | 	btst	#5,%sp@(PT_OFF_SR)	/* check if returning to kernel*/ | 
 | 	jeq	Luser_return		/* if so, skip resched, signals*/ | 
 |  | 
 | Lkernel_return: | 
 | 	RESTORE_ALL | 
 |  | 
 | Luser_return: | 
 | 	/* only allow interrupts when we are really the last one on the*/ | 
 | 	/* kernel stack, otherwise stack overflow can occur during*/ | 
 | 	/* heavy interrupt load*/ | 
 | 	andw	#ALLOWINT,%sr | 
 |  | 
 | 	movel	%sp,%d1			/* get thread_info pointer */ | 
 | 	andl	#-THREAD_SIZE,%d1 | 
 | 	movel	%d1,%a2 | 
 | 1: | 
 | 	move	%a2@(TINFO_FLAGS),%d1	/* thread_info->flags */ | 
 | 	jne	Lwork_to_do | 
 | 	RESTORE_ALL | 
 |  | 
 | Lwork_to_do: | 
 | 	movel	%a2@(TINFO_FLAGS),%d1	/* thread_info->flags */ | 
 | 	btst	#TIF_NEED_RESCHED,%d1 | 
 | 	jne	reschedule | 
 |  | 
 | Lsignal_return: | 
 | 	subql	#4,%sp			/* dummy return address*/ | 
 | 	SAVE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	pea	%sp@(SWITCH_STACK_SIZE) | 
 | 	bsrw	do_notify_resume | 
 | 	addql	#4,%sp | 
 | 	RESTORE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	addql	#4,%sp | 
 | 	jra	1b |

 | /* | 
 |  * This is the main interrupt handler, responsible for calling process_int() | 
 |  */ | 
 | inthandler1: | 
 | 	SAVE_ALL_INT | 
 | 	movew	%sp@(PT_OFF_FORMATVEC), %d0 | 
 | 	and	#0x3ff, %d0 | 
 |  | 
 | 	movel	%sp,%sp@- | 
 | 	movel	#65,%sp@- 		/*  put vector # on stack*/ | 
 | 	jbsr	process_int		/*  process the IRQ*/ | 
 | 3:     	addql	#8,%sp			/*  pop parameters off stack*/ | 
 | 	bra	ret_from_exception |

 | /* | 
 |  * Handler for uninitialized and spurious interrupts. | 
 |  */ | 
 | ENTRY(bad_interrupt) | 
 | 	addql	#1,irq_err_count | 
 | 	rte | 
 |  | 
 | /* | 
 |  * Beware - when entering resume, prev (the current task) is | 
 |  * in a0, next (the new task) is in a1, so don't change these | 
 |  * registers until their contents are no longer needed. | 
 |  */ | 
 | ENTRY(resume) | 
 | 	movel	%a0,%d1				/* save prev thread in d1 */ | 
 | 	movew	%sr,%a0@(TASK_THREAD+THREAD_SR)	/* save sr */ | 
 | 	SAVE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	movel	%sp,%a0@(TASK_THREAD+THREAD_KSP) /* save kernel stack */ | 
 | 	movel	%usp,%a3			/* save usp */ | 
 | 	movel	%a3,%a0@(TASK_THREAD+THREAD_USP) | 
 |  | 
 | 	movel	%a1@(TASK_THREAD+THREAD_USP),%a3 /* restore user stack */ | 
 | 	movel	%a3,%usp | 
 | 	movel	%a1@(TASK_THREAD+THREAD_KSP),%sp /* restore new thread stack */ | 
 | 	RESTORE_SWITCH_STACK | 
 | 	movew	%a1@(TASK_THREAD+THREAD_SR),%sr	/* restore thread status reg */ | 
 | 	rts |
